Comanche vs West Indian Unemployment Among Ages 30 to 34 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 107,264,456 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Comanche and unemployment rate among population between the ages 30 and 34 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.331 and weighted average of 6.3%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 246,603,310 people shows no correlation between the proportion of West Indians and unemployment rate among population between the ages 30 and 34 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.011 and weighted average of 6.5%, a difference of 3.7%.
